Topping them they could see the black, craggy summits of the curious volcanic hills which rise upon the Libyan side.

On the crest of the low sand-hills they would catch a glimpse every now and then of a tall, sky-blue soldier, walking swiftly, his rifle at the trail.

For a moment the lank, warlike figure would be sharply silhouetted against the sky.

Then he would dip into a hollow and disappear, while some hundred yards off another would show for an instant and vanish.
"Wherever are they raised ?" asked Sadie, watching the moving figures.
"They look to me just about the same tint as the hotel boys in the States." "I thought some question might arise about them," said Mr.Stephens, who was never so happy as when he could anticipate some wish of the pretty American.
